Urbanisation increases cloudiness over Greater Kuala Lumpur during southwest and northeast monsoons

Understanding urban cloud dynamics is vital, as changes in local cloud patterns impact energy and water cycles, posing risks to cities. This study examined urban cloudiness using Himawari-8 satellite data from 2016 to 2021 during the southwest and northeast monsoons in Greater Kuala Lumpur. Urban areas exhibited higher daytime cloud cover than rural areas, with peak cloudiness at 1500 local time being 1.22 times greater during southwest monsoon and 1.24 times greater during the northeast monsoon. Increased solar radiation and the urban heat island effect drive these variations, offering insights for weather forecasting and climate studies in rapidly urbanising regions.</p>
